The so-called non-locality theorems aim to show that Quantum Mechanics is notconsistent with the Locality Principle. Their proofs require, besides the standard pos-tulates of Quantum Theory, further conditions, as for instance the Criterion of Reality,which cannot be formulated in the language of Standard Quantum Theory; this di±-culty makes the proofs not veri¯able according to usual logico-mathematical methods,and therefore it is a source of the controversial debate about the real implications ofthese theorems. The present work addresses this di±culty for Bell-type and Stapp'sarguments of non-locality. We supplement the formalism of Quantum Mechanics withformal statements inferred from the further conditions in the two di®erent cases. Thenan analysis of the two arguments is performed according to ordinary mathematicallogic.
